Test Recordings

Each test run triggered via our cloud includes a recording screen with a video recording on the left and triggered logs on the right, including network request payloads and device logs with info, debug, and error logs.

As the video plays, the logs synchronize to show what occurred before an error.

Interactions

Just like the execution found in the , every screen interaction is captured with a screenshot, accompanied by an icon pinpointing the exact location of the interaction. This detailed recording is conveniently displayed in the Interactions tab for your reference.
